Definitions of flavor enhancer words

  • noun flavor enhancer a substance added to food in order to enhance or intensify its flavor: Salt is a common flavor enhancer. 1
  • noun flavor enhancer Any substance added to a food product to enhance its taste, especially to make it taste more savoury or to add umami. 0
